The Electrified Heartbeat: A Commitment to Efficiency and Performance

The most significant headline for the 2026 RAV4 is undoubtedly its unwavering commitment to electrification. Dropping the traditional internal combustion engine entirely is a powerful declaration, signaling Toyota’s deep investment in a sustainable future. This strategic pivot ensures every new RAV4 owner benefits from superior RAV4 Hybrid MPG and reduced emissions, a crucial consideration for today’s discerning consumers.

At the core of the standard hybrid system is a familiar yet refined 2.5-liter inline-four engine, now seamlessly integrated with a pair of electric motors to deliver a combined 236 horsepower. This setup isn’t about raw, neck-snapping acceleration – that’s never been the RAV4’s primary mission. Instead, it’s about smart, responsive power delivery, especially beneficial in stop-and-go city traffic where the electric motors do most of the heavy lifting. From a practical standpoint, this translates to smooth, confident merging onto highways and ample passing power when needed, all while sipping fuel with remarkable frugality. When considering fuel-efficient SUV 2026 models, the RAV4 Hybrid immediately stands out.

For those demanding even greater electric capability and a truly elevated performance profile, the 2026 RAV4 Prime returns, leveraging the same robust 2.5-liter engine but pairing it with a larger battery pack. This Plug-in Hybrid (PHEV) SUV variant offers a substantial all-electric driving range, making daily commutes potentially emission-free for many drivers. Beyond the environmental benefits, the RAV4 Prime also boasts a significant boost in total system output, providing a more spirited driving experience that might surprise those accustomed to hybrid norms. Furthermore, the potential for federal and state electric vehicle tax credit incentives associated with PHEVs makes the Prime an even more attractive proposition, offering both a greener footprint and a potentially lower cost of ownership hybrid SUV. Toyota’s decision to offer both robust hybrid and potent plug-in options effectively caters to a broad spectrum of buyers, solidifying its position in the evolving hybrid SUV market share 2025.

Beyond the Hood: A Tech-Forward Cabin That Finally Delivers

For years, one persistent critique of the RAV4, despite its undeniable strengths, centered on its infotainment system. It was functional, certainly, but often felt a step behind the competition. For 2026, Toyota has emphatically silenced those critics. The new-generation RAV4 finally receives the comprehensive technological overhaul it deserved, integrating Toyota’s latest multimedia system that truly elevates the in-cabin experience. This isn’t just an incremental update; it’s a leap forward in terms of intuitiveness, responsiveness, and feature richness.

The moment you settle into the driver’s seat, the difference is palpable. A vivid, high-resolution driver’s display offers a customizable array of information, from vital vehicle statistics to navigation prompts, all presented with crisp clarity. Adjacent to it, the primary infotainment touchscreen—offered in generous sizes—serves as the command center for navigation, audio, communication, and climate controls. The interface is remarkably intuitive, featuring sharp graphics, quick response times, and a logical menu structure that minimizes distraction. Crucially, w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to are standard, ensuring seamless smartphone integration, a feature that has become non-negotiable for most modern drivers seeking automotive connectivity features.

Beyond the basic functionality, this new system boasts a more expansive and refined feature set. The integrated navigation system is robust, offering clear map overlays and intelligent routing. The voice assistant is notably more natural and effective than previous iterations, allowing drivers to control various functions with simple spoken commands, further enhancing safety and convenience. Furthermore, adjustable driver monitoring systems and smart drive mode layouts are integrated, providing a truly personalized and engaged driving environment. For anyone considering SUV technology 2026, the RAV4’s updated suite is a serious contender.

While the new tech is universally praised, the broader interior design, particularly the multi-level center console, can still be a point of debate. Some find its layered approach ingenious for maximizing storage and accessibility, while others might perceive it as a bit busy. As an expert, I lean towards appreciating its functionality; the sheer number of cubbies and thoughtful storage solutions make it incredibly practical for daily use and long road trips. The materials used throughout the cabin feel durable and well-assembled, striking a good balance between ruggedness and comfort, reflecting the RAV4’s dual nature as a capable adventurer and a comfortable daily driver.

Safety as a Standard: Unwavering Confidence with Toyota Safety Sense 4.0

Safety has always been a cornerstone of the Toyota brand, and the 2026 RAV4 reinforces this commitment with the latest iteration of its comprehensive suite of driver assistance and active safety features: Toyota Safety Sense 4.0 (TSS 4.0). This advanced system isn’t just about passive protection in the event of a collision; it’s about proactive prevention and enhancing driver awareness, providing an unparalleled sense of confidence on the road.

TSS 4.0 brings with it several notable advancements that make driving the RAV4 feel more secure and less fatiguing. The Pre-Collision System, with enhanced pedestrian and cyclist detection, now functions more effectively in varied lighting conditions and at higher speeds. Lane Departure Alert with Steering Assist is refined, providing gentle but firm nudges to keep the vehicle centered. The most impressive updates, however, come in the form of enhanced Adaptive Cruise Control and Lane Tracing Assist. When engaged, these systems work in harmony, not only maintaining a set distance from the vehicle ahead but also keeping the RAV4 confidently and smoothly centered within its lane, even on gentle curves. This significantly reduces driver fatigue on long journeys.

A particularly convenient new function allows for automatic lane changes with a simple tap of the turn signal. This intelligent system, after verifying that the adjacent lane is clear, smoothly maneuvers the vehicle, adding another layer of sophistication to the driving experience. From a user expert perspective, these advanced safety systems vehicles like the RAV4 now offer are not just marketing bullet points; they are tangible benefits that contribute to accident prevention and overall driver well-being. When considering a best family SUV hybrid, the robust safety credentials of the 2026 RAV4 are a paramount factor.

Driving Dynamics: Familiarity with a Touch of Refinement

Upon getting behind the wheel of the 2026 RAV4, the immediate sensation for anyone familiar with the previous generation is one of reassuring familiarity. This isn’t a radical departure in driving dynamics, and for many, that’s precisely the appeal. The RAV4 has always prioritized practicality, reliability, and ease of use, and these core tenets remain firmly in place.

The 2.5-liter hybrid powertrain, while more efficient, still exhibits a characteristic Toyota four-cylinder hum under hard acceleration. While some might find it a bit coarse when pushed, for the vast majority of daily driving scenarios – navigating city streets, cruising on the highway – the power delivery is more than adequate, seamlessly blending electric and gasoline propulsion. The ride quality is firm but generally composed, absorbing most road imperfections without undue harshness. It’s not a magic carpet ride, but it effectively takes the hard edges off rough pavement, providing a comfortable enough experience for commuting or family road trips.

Steering and braking are predictable and linear, instilling confidence without providing excessive feedback or sporting pretensions. This predictable nature is often a positive attribute for a mainstream compact SUV, appealing to a broad audience who prioritize ease of operation over razor-sharp dynamics. While the RAV4 driving review might not feature words like “exhilarating” or “sporty,” it excels in “reliable,” “stable,” and “manageable.” This balanced approach to hybrid SUV handling ensures the RAV4 remains accessible and enjoyable for a wide range of drivers, cementing its position as a strong contender in compact SUV ride comfort.

One minor point of contention from previous models that persists is the somewhat shallow opening of the rear doors. While not a deal-breaker, it can make ingress and egress slightly less graceful for taller passengers or those with bulky child seats. However, this is a minor ergonomic quibble in an otherwise highly practical and thoughtfully designed package.
